U.S. Embassy in India issues advisory on student visa compliance

On May 27, the U.S. Embassy in India issued an important advisory via Platform X (formerly Twitter), reminding international students of the critical need to comply with student visa regulations. The Embassy warned that students who drop out, skip classes, or leave their program of study without notifying their school may face visa revocation and lose eligibility for future U.S. visas.
